Job Description
About the job
Reporting to the Sales and Supply Support Manager, this SPECIALIST role (Official Job Title is Sales & Supply Support Specialist) will contribute to a great meeting with customers in the store by ensuring a consistently high availability of our product offers, with the highest quality, and at lowest possible cost.
Your assignment
You secure the highest possible products availability in the store, in partnership with the Commercial Team, and in consideration of country-specific positioning campaigns, the commercial calendar and local store activities;
You work actively with the Sales Team in product range management by quality and timely administration of the product range in the system;
You contribute to successful product replenishments by working actively with forecasting and ordering, in alignment with the commercial calendar;
You work actively and proactively with the Commercial Team on the product range change process by providing information regarding sales space parameters, expected sales start, quantity and remaining outgoing quantities;
You support the Goods Flow Manager with stock discrepancies analysis, as part of the inventory management process;
You produce necessary follow-ups for the Commercial and Management teams regarding operational processes in the store, including phasing in and out, overstock and concrete activities, and non-central shortages.
Qualifications
You are highly interested in home furnishing, people's life at home, and the IKEA product range;
You are passionate about logistics and working in a fast-paced and constantly changing retail environment;
You have at least 3 years of relevant experience in a fast-paced retail or logistics environment, with focus on supply chain, demand planning / forecasting;
You possess high analytical and numerical skills, are skilled in supporting an efficient and cost-effective commercial performance, and able to make objective decisions based on monitoring and reviewing of the in-store Logistics system and other available information;
You possess exc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build trust and establish and maintain effective work relationships with cross-departmental colleagues.
